Redefining Productivity Without The Guilt

The modern man is no longer buying into the myth that productivity equals constant exhaustion. Instead of glorifying burnout, he’s learning how energy management beats time management every single day. By identifying peak focus hours, he works with his biology rather than fighting it. This shift removes the shame spiral that used to follow procrastination, replacing it with curiosity and adjustment. When guilt disappears, momentum becomes easier to build and maintain.

Turning Dopamine From Enemy To Ally

For years, dopamine was framed as the villain behind endless scrolling and distraction. Now, smarter strategies are teaching men how to use dopamine intentionally rather than fear it. Small wins, visible progress, and immediate feedback loops are being engineered into daily routines. This turns motivation into something renewable instead of a resource that runs out by noon. When reward systems are designed on purpose, procrastination loses much of its grip.

Using Systems Instead Of Willpower

Willpower is finally being exposed as unreliable, especially in a world engineered for distraction. Modern men are building systems that make action the default choice rather than the heroic one. From environment design to automation tools, friction is being removed before it can sabotage momentum. This approach shifts the question from “Why can’t I start?” to “How can I make starting inevitable?” Once systems take over, consistency becomes far less exhausting.

Embracing Identity Over Motivation

One of the biggest breakthroughs is the shift from outcome-based thinking to identity-based action. Instead of forcing motivation, men are asking, “What would someone like me do next?” This subtle change rewires behavior at a deeper level because identity drives habits effortlessly. When a man sees himself as disciplined, focused, or reliable, his actions begin to follow naturally. Procrastination fades when it no longer fits the story he tells about himself.

Replacing Hustle Culture With Sustainable Focus

The nonstop hustle narrative is losing its shine, and that’s a good thing. Modern men are discovering that sustainable focus beats frantic effort every time. Deep work, deliberate rest, and clear boundaries are becoming status symbols in their own right. This approach protects mental health while still producing impressive results. By working smarter instead of louder, procrastination has far fewer places to hide.

Using Technology With Intention, Not Addiction

Technology used to be the ultimate distraction, but now it’s being reprogrammed as an ally. Smart reminders, focus modes, and digital minimalism strategies help reduce decision fatigue. Men are curating their digital environments instead of being controlled by them. When technology serves intention rather than impulse, attention becomes a powerful tool. The same devices that once fueled delay now support meaningful progress.

How The Modern Man Is Ending Procrastination
Image source: Shutterstock.com

Rewriting Failure As Feedback

Procrastination often thrives on fear of failure, but that narrative is being challenged head-on. Modern men are learning to treat mistakes as data instead of personal indictments. This mindset lowers emotional risk and encourages faster action. When failure becomes information, starting feels safer and more productive. Momentum grows when perfection is no longer the entry requirement.

Building Accountability That Actually Works

Accountability is evolving beyond nagging reminders and public pressure. Men are choosing accountability systems rooted in trust, clarity, and shared goals. Whether through peers, mentors, or structured check-ins, support now feels empowering rather than embarrassing. This creates a sense of forward motion even on low-energy days. Procrastination struggles to survive in an environment where progress is noticed and reinforced.

The End Of Waiting And The Start Of Momentum

The modern man isn’t defeating procrastination by fighting himself harder; he’s doing it by understanding himself better. Through smarter systems, healthier identity shifts, and intentional use of technology, action is becoming the natural response instead of the exception. This evolution isn’t about perfection or pressure, but about alignment and awareness. The result is a life that moves forward with clarity instead of constant delay.
